Malaysia’s Petronas Dagangan 3Q net profit more than triples on year

KUALA LUMPUR: Petronas Dagangan, a Malaysia-based retailer and marketer of oil and gas products, said Friday its net profit more than tripled on year in the third quarter, aided by contributions from retail and commercial segments.

Net profit for the period ended Sep. 30 stood at 761.73 million ringgit ($181.70 million) versus 248.76 million ringgit a year earlier, the company said in an exchange filing. Quarterly revenue rose by 22.2% on year at 6.69 billion ringgit.

“The Directors are of the opinion that the business environment outlook for the upcoming months of FY2017 remains challenging,” Petronas Dagangan said. “The Group will continue to focus on inventory management, supply and distribution efficiency as well as operating expenditure optimisation to ensure the Company remains resilient.”
